> Isn't this what team karma is for?
Well, not exactly. Team karma is identical to personal Karma Pools except
that any team member can make use of it if they get a majority vote. Most
NPC's do not (by definition) count as team members. Occasionally I allow an
NPC to draw from the team Karma Pool if all team members agree to it though,
but that is just my ruling, not the books.
